ed eb9b8aad2e fix(scripts): visit_Try walker now visits ALL except handlers
The audit script's visit_Try had a bug where the
\or child in handler.body\ loop was OUTSIDE the
\or handler in node.handlers\ loop. So \handler\ was bound
to the LAST handler, and only the last handler's body was walked.
Raises in non-last except handlers were missed (e.g.,
src/rag_engine.py:31 was not in the audit findings).

The fix moves the inner loop inside the outer loop so each
handler's body is walked. Both the FIRST and LAST handler raises
are now detected.

Adds tests/test_audit_exception_handling_bug_fixes.py with 2
tests for the walker behavior (first-handler raise, middle-handler
raise in a 3-handler try).

ed fd5175bf7b fix(tier2): override MCP server path + reset mcp_paths.toml in clone
Follow-up to 9cd85364. The previous fix patched the OpenCode session-
level permission.read/write allowlist to include the sandbox clone
path, but Tier 2 was still hitting 'ACCESS DENIED' on clone paths.

Root cause: the MCP server has its OWN allowlist that's separate from
OpenCode's session-level permission. The MCP server's allowlist =
project_root (parent dir of the script) + extra_dirs from
mcp_paths.toml in the project root. The clone inherited the main
repo's mcp.manual-slop.command via 'git clone', which launched
C:\\projects\\manual_slop\\scripts\\mcp_server.py with
PYTHONPATH=C:\\projects\\manual_slop\\src. So the MCP server was
using the main repo's project_root + the main repo's mcp_paths.toml
(extra_dirs=['C:/projects/gencpp']) -- exactly the
'Allowed base directories are: gencpp, manual_slop' the user saw.

Fix: setup_tier2_clone.ps1 now overrides the clone's mcp.manual-slop
config to point at the CLONE's scripts/mcp_server.py and src/, and
replaces the clone's mcp_paths.toml with an empty extra_dirs list.
The MCP server's allowlist becomes [C:\\projects\\manual_slop_tier2]
only -- the sandbox boundary.

Added test_setup_script_overrides_mcp_server (text-based regression)
to assert the script contains the required overrides. Opt-in via
TIER2_SANDBOX_TESTS=1.

Verified: re-ran setup against the live clone. opencode.json now has
mcp.manual-slop.command pointing at C:\\projects\\manual_slop_tier2\\
scripts\\mcp_server.py with PYTHONPATH=C:\\projects\\manual_slop_tier2\\
src. mcp_paths.toml has 'extra_dirs = []'.

ed cc2105dc65 docs(tier2): what's special about test_z_negative_flows
User asked why this test is uniquely affected. Answer: it's the ONLY
tier-3 test where the AI call runs ASYNCHRONOUSLY in the io_pool worker
while the imgui-bundle render loop continues on the main thread.

Verified: test_visual_orchestration.py::test_mma_epic_lifecycle uses
the same provider setup (gemini_cli + mock_gemini_cli.py + click) but
calls orchestrator_pm.generate_tracks() synchronously in the main
thread, blocking the render loop. It PASSES in 11s.

test_mma_step_mode_sim.py::test_mma_step_mode_approval_flow also uses
the async path but is @pytest.mark.skipif(not RUN_MMA_INTEGRATION) -
skipped by default. Would likely also crash if unsuppressed.

All other MockProvider tests short-circuit at ai_client.send and never
spawn a subprocess.

The crash is on the MAIN thread (1.94 MB stack, verified via
kernel32.GetCurrentThreadStackLimits), not the io_pool worker (which
has 8MB after threading.stack_size(8MB) patch). The main thread's
imgui-bundle render loop runs concurrently with the io_pool worker's
subprocess.Popen / process.communicate. The accumulated imgui-bundle
C++ frames exhaust the main thread's 1.94 MB stack.

This explains:
- Why bumping io_pool stack to 8MB doesn't help (the patch can't reach
  the main thread, which was created before any sitecustomize runs).
- Why the standalone subprocess call works (no render loop concurrent).
- Why the no-click baseline survives 60s (no AI call to trigger the race).

Next step: capture a Windows crash dump via procdump or cdb.exe to
confirm the crashing thread is the main thread and identify the
specific imgui-bundle C++ stack frame.

ed 9fcf0517c7 fix(theme): correct add_rect argument types in AlertPulsing.render
src/theme_nerv_fx.py:97 was calling draw_list.add_rect with positional
args (rounding, thickness, flags) but the int/float types were swapped:
  rounding=0.0  (correct)
  thickness=0   (int, signature expects float)
  flags=10.0    (float, signature expects int)

The TypeError fires every render frame once ai_status starts with
'error'. App.run's except RuntimeError eventually catches and calls
self.shutdown() -> controller.shutdown() -> _io_pool.shutdown(wait=False).
Subsequent tests in the same live_gui session can't submit_io.

Test 1 (test_mock_malformed_json) passes because its in-flight worker
completes before the io_pool shutdown is observed. Tests 2 and 3 fail
because their clicks are silently swallowed by the submit_io RuntimeError.

Switch to keyword args with correct types. Update test_theme_nerv_fx
assertion to match.

Refs: conductor/tracks/send_result_to_send_20260616/ - was identified
during final verification but initially scapegoated as 'pre-existing'.
Per user feedback, the bug is fixed now.

Verified: test_theme_nerv_fx 5/5 pass. test_z_negative_flows.py
isolation results mixed (test 1 passes; tests 2/3 surface a separate
conftest live_gui isolation bug that needs separate investigation).
